On September 11, 1987
Advertisements [?]
Three gunmen broke into his Kingston home, killing the singer and two others, and wounding four other people. Peter Tosh’s funeral was held in the National Arena before thousands of mourners.



Always the revolutionary, Tosh was a prime exponent of the notion that there can be no peace without equal rights and justice. His words were the rallying cry of the Los Angeles uprising, and of oppressed peoples everywhere.
